Lines Matching refs:funcs

1287 …PetscErrorCode (*funcs[NUM_FIELDS + 1])(PetscInt, PetscReal, const PetscReal[], PetscInt, PetscSca…  in ProjectAuxDM()  local
1333 funcs[C_FIELD_ID] = zerof; in ProjectAuxDM()
1335 funcs[P_FIELD_ID] = zerof; in ProjectAuxDM()
1337 funcs[NUM_FIELDS] = source; in ProjectAuxDM()
1339 PetscCall(DMProjectFunction(dmAux, time, funcs, ctxs, INSERT_ALL_VALUES, a)); in ProjectAuxDM()
1361 …PetscErrorCode (*funcs[NUM_FIELDS])(PetscInt, PetscReal, const PetscReal[], PetscInt, PetscScalar … in CreatePotentialNullSpace() local
1364 funcs[nfield] = constantf; in CreatePotentialNullSpace()
1366 PetscCall(DMProjectFunction(dm, 0.0, funcs, NULL, INSERT_ALL_VALUES, vec)); in CreatePotentialNullSpace()
1777 …PetscErrorCode (*funcs[NUM_FIELDS])(PetscInt, PetscReal, const PetscReal[], PetscInt, PetscScalar … in SetInitialConditionsAndTolerances() local
1784 funcs[C_FIELD_ID] = initial_conditions_C_0; in SetInitialConditionsAndTolerances()
1787 funcs[C_FIELD_ID] = initial_conditions_C_1; in SetInitialConditionsAndTolerances()
1790 funcs[C_FIELD_ID] = initial_conditions_C_2; in SetInitialConditionsAndTolerances()
1793 funcs[C_FIELD_ID] = initial_conditions_C_random; in SetInitialConditionsAndTolerances()
1802 funcs[P_FIELD_ID] = zerof; in SetInitialConditionsAndTolerances()
1803 PetscCall(DMProjectFunction(dm, t, funcs, ctxs, INSERT_ALL_VALUES, u)); in SetInitialConditionsAndTolerances()
1899 …void (*funcs[NUM_FIELDS])(PetscInt dim, PetscInt Nf, PetscInt NfAux, const PetscInt uOff[], const … in ResizeSetUp()
1902 funcs[P_FIELD_ID] = ellipticity_fail; in ResizeSetUp()
1903 funcs[C_FIELD_ID] = NULL; in ResizeSetUp()
1906 PetscCall(DMProjectField(dm, 0, u, funcs, INSERT_VALUES, ellVec)); in ResizeSetUp()
1974 …void (*funcs[])(PetscInt dim, PetscInt Nf, PetscInt NfAux, const PetscInt uOff[], const PetscInt u… in ComputeDiagnostic() local
2005 PetscCall(DMProjectField(ctx->view_dm, 0.0, u, funcs, INSERT_VALUES, *out)); in ComputeDiagnostic()